Update an existing image to an alpha image
Last updated at 1:33 pm UTC on 16 January 2006
Update an existing release image to an alpha image via the server:

Note: The example below is for updating from a 3.5 image to a 3.6alpha image. However, the process is basically the same for updating from 3.6 to 3.7alpha, etc. (Simply use 'Squeak3.7alpha' in the SystemVersion command instead.)

For Squeak Alpha Testing:

If you wish to be a test pilot and receive further updates that may or may not improve the quality of your Squeak, then....

To enable your 3.5 release image to accept the updates for 3.6alpha...

Remember, you will be filing this stuff in 'at your own risk'. Test Pilots and Guinea Pigs only.
